The Surprise Long Foretold

Long had the faithful whispered of his return, though years had passed since Sir Mark had last trod the ballroom floor. Having ventured into the realm of music and retreated into the quietude of private life, he had declared in the year of 2023 that his days of competitive dance were behind him. Thus, few believed they would see his noble visage again beneath the gleam of the stage lights.

But lo, the scribes and stewards of the show had plotted in silence. Knowing the need for a spark — a fresh yet familiar flame — they summoned the knight of rhythm and heart, and Sir Mark did answer the call.

Even the brave souls who now danced for glory in the season were taken aback. “It was as though a dream had taken flesh,” one performer whispered. “Like a vision from the past stepped forth to guide us anew.”
